Alley Theatre, Peace Education, Louisville Sports Commissioner, & Inn at Woodhaven
Visit with actors at Alley Theatre; the Peace Education Program teaches conflict resolution, peer mediation, and prejudice reduction; an interview with Karl Schmitt, executive director of the Louisville Sports Commission; and built in 1853, the Inn at Woodhaven is a bed and breakfast listed on the National Register because of its architectural significance.
